Output 61f4efd8b2064855aa8c2728c3644ee5d72e06bc3e78b1ac9c76e47b31e9968e:1

value
2436437094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 149facdd494d2e27c01d495f15c4969561dce4d6 OP_EQUAL
address
33a4ip1bfAfK5JvNX5Eu3n5P1xiefRPyK1
transaction
61f4efd8b2064855aa8c2728c3644ee5d72e06bc3e78b1ac9c76e47b31e9968e
confirmations
373083
spent
true